I just got the game today, love the game, but if I exit out and come back to it later everything is overexposed. If the refresh rate is set to 60 switching to 75 fixes it and vice versa. What could be causing this? All my drivers are up to date. Game settings Res:1440x900, 4xAA, HDR, High Detail. Graphics card is a Powercolor Radeon HD 4670 1GB.

HDR stands for High Dynamic Range. It basically simulates how our eyes react to changes in light levels. IE Overexposure with a lot of light in the scene and and increase in contrast when there isn't a lot of light.

Or, to describe it in another way, it is at least 100 times brighter outside than it is inside. But you don't really notice the difference unless you are directly contrasting the two, i.e. you're in a hallway staring out at a bright sunny day.
